Aishwarya Rai Bachchan: Raising a Voice Against Harassment

Aishwarya Rai Bachchan, an influential figure on the global stage, has consistently used her platform to advocate for women’s empowerment and safety, notably by speaking out against harassment. Her statements emphasize the critical importance of self-worth and the responsibility of the community to tackle this pervasive issue.

A significant part of her public advocacy came through her association with the L’Oréal Paris’ “Stand Up Against Street Harassment” training program. In various interviews and a widely shared social media video, Aishwarya directly addressed the common, yet often dismissed, issue of street harassment. Her message serves as a powerful antidote to victim-blaming culture, urging women to reject traditional advice that places the burden of safety on them.

She challenged the notion that women should shrink themselves or avoid eye contact to stay safe. Instead, her rallying cry is to “Look the problem directly in the eyes,” and “Hold your head high.”

The core of Aishwarya Rai’s message is a strong repudiation of the idea that a woman’s actions or appearance are responsible for the harassment she faces. She made it unequivocally clear: “Street harassment is never your fault.”

She directly told women, “Don’t blame your dress or your lipstick,” thereby challenging the societal tendency to scrutinize a victim’s clothing rather than the harasser’s actions. Her words are a powerful affirmation of inherent value, encapsulated in the statement, “My body, my worth. Never compromise your worth. Do not doubt yourself. Stand up for your worth.” This emphasizes that a woman’s value is non-negotiable and independent of external validation or criticism.

Beyond street harassment, Aishwarya has also voiced her support for the wider #MeToo movement, describing its momentum as a positive sign that has been a “need of the hour since time immemorial.” She expressed solidarity and offered strength to the women coming forward with their painful stories, acknowledging that social media has given a voice to those who might otherwise have been silenced.

More notably, her support hasn’t been limited to words. Reports indicate that she took a decisive action by walking out of a film project in the past after learning that the producer had been accused of domestic abuse. This personal stand, which sacrificed a professional opportunity, serves as a powerful example of her commitment to supporting victims and refusing to collaborate with abusers—a testament to her belief that her professional conduct must align with her moral principles.

In essence, Aishwarya Rai Bachchan’s statements on harassment are an inspirational call to action, promoting courage, self-respect, and collective responsibility. Her consistent message encourages women to recognize their innate worth and confront injustice head-on, while also pressuring society to acknowledge that harassment is solely the fault of the perpetrator.
